Booster Straps

Booster Straps are designed to make a ski boot flex more evenly. They come in four different flexes J3-J4, Standard, Expert and World Cup. The different flexes allow a skier to stiffen or soften their boots.

-Stiffer boots give you better rebound, which helps in keeping you centered on your skis.
-Softer boots allow for a greater range of movement and can help in reducing shin bang.

Depending on your intended goals Boosters can be used to replace your power strap or in conjunction with them. A proper bootfitter can help you install your straps as well as find the right Booster Strap combination for you.
